It's stressful at times when you have a job and go to school, but as long as you have a reasonable boss you should be fine. Don't stay at a job that keeps you until all hours of the night on school nights. That's just unreasonable. Don't work for someone who wants you to work during school hours either. See if you can work only three or four hours on school nights and more on the weekends. Working long hours on school nights will probably lead to you not getting your work done. If you can't manage to get your school work done while you're working, you should concider only working weekends and when you have breaks from school. School and activities should definatly come before work while you're still in high school. [ devilspawn_666's advice column | Ask devilspawn_666 A Question ]
